Civil litigation cases can be complex and intimidating, but understanding your rights is the first step to ensuring a fair outcome. Whether you're pursuing a claim or defending yourself, knowing what protections and opportunities are afforded to you under the law can make a significant difference.
1. The Right to Legal Representation
One of your most important rights in civil litigation is the right to legal representation. While you may choose to represent yourself, hiring a qualified attorney ensures that your case is handled with the expertise it deserves. Your attorney will guide you through the process, from filing documents to negotiating settlements or presenting your case in court.
2. The Right to Due Process
Due process ensures that every party in a civil case is treated fairly. This includes receiving proper notice of proceedings, having an opportunity to present evidence, and cross-examining witnesses. It’s your right to have a clear understanding of the claims or defenses in your case and to challenge them appropriately.
3. The Right to Discovery
During the discovery phase, both parties exchange information relevant to the case. You have the right to request documents, ask questions through interrogatories, and depose witnesses. This process ensures transparency and helps build a strong case.
4. The Right to a Fair Trial
If your case proceeds to trial, you are entitled to a fair and impartial hearing. This means a neutral judge, adherence to court rules, and the opportunity to present your side of the story fully.
5. The Right to Appeal
If the judgment doesn’t go in your favor, you have the right to appeal the decision to a higher court. Appeals allow you to challenge potential errors made during the trial, such as misapplication of the law or procedural violations.
